BSc Honours Building Surveying

Course Overview

The BSc (Honours) Building Surveying course at Sheffield Hallam University is a pathway profession in demand in today's world. This academic programme serves as a platform for an exciting career in building surveying.

SHU's curriculum is built around the practical skills and theoretical knowledge you will need to excel. You will understand key areas in the field, with a focus on hands-on learning through many live projects where you will work directly with industry professionals.

Additionally, the course has dual accreditation from the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S) and the Chartered Institute of Building (CIOB), giving you an advantage in your career after completing your studies.

About University

Sheffield Hallam University (SHU) is based in the city of Sheffield and is a leader of practical and career-focused education. The university was founded in 1843 and it is now one of the largest universities in the UK, ranked in the top 1000-1200 globally (QS World University Rankings 2025) and a holder of a gold rating in the 2023 Teaching Excellence Framework.

As a student, you will learn in state-of-the-art facilities while you are also being guided by faculty teaching staff who bring a combination of their research and hands-on expertise. SHU’s City Campus is well-positioned in the city centre, close to Sheffield’s transport hubs, and right in the middle of the city's industrial landscape.

Entry Requirements

To apply for the BSc (Honours) Building Surveying, you will need to submit a personal statement showcasing your passion for the built environment, a reference from an academic or employer, and details of your previous qualifications.

Grade Requirements:

  • Applicants require a minimum of 112 UCAS tariff points, typically from three A-levels (or equivalent), with no specific subject requirements, though subjects like Mathematics, Physics, or Design Technology are advantageous.
  • Equivalent international qualifications, such as an International Baccalaureate, are accepted.
  • Applicants with relevant work experience or non-standard qualifications are encouraged to apply, as SHU values diverse pathways.

English Proficiency:

  • Applicants from non-English-speaking backgrounds need an IELTS score of 6.0 overall, with no component below 5.5.
  • Equivalent test scores, such as TOEFL or PTE, are also accepted.

Careers

The BSc (Honours) Building Surveying prepares you for rewarding roles in construction, property management, and real estate. Graduates are equipped for positions such as:

  • Building Surveyor
  • Property Consultant
  • Facilities Manager
  • Project Manager
  • Conservation Surveyor
